Biography

Dr Ahmed Abdalla is a Senior Lecturer (tenured Assistant Professor) in the Department of Accounting, Monash University, Australia. He has been a research scholar at Columbia University in New York City and a visiting scholar at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ill. Prior to joining Monash, he has been a full-time faculty fellow at the London School of Economics.

Ahmed received a Ph.D. in Accounting and Finance from King’s College London and completed part of his doctoral training at the University of Cambridge.

Ahmed’s main research interests are the macroeconomic consequences of firm-level accounting information and the valuation of equity.

His research is accepted/published in the Accounting Review, Journal of Monetary Economics, and Review of Accounting Studies.
